+package security
+
+import (
+ "testing"
+
+ qt "github.com/frankban/quicktest"
+ "github.com/gohugoio/hugo/config"
+)
+
+func TestDecodeConfigFromTOML(t *testing.T) {
+ c := qt.New(t)
+
+ c.Run("Slice whitelist", func(c *qt.C) {
+ c.Parallel()
+ tomlConfig := `
+
+
+someOtherValue = "bar"
+
+[security]
+enableInlineShortcodes=true
+[security.exec]
+allow=["a", "b"]
+osEnv=["a", "b", "c"]
+[security.funcs]
+getEnv=["a", "b"]
+
+`
+
+ cfg, err := config.FromConfigString(tomlConfig, "toml")
+ c.Assert(err, qt.IsNil)
+
+ pc, err := DecodeConfig(cfg)
+ c.Assert(err, qt.IsNil)
+ c.Assert(pc, qt.Not(qt.IsNil))
+ c.Assert(pc.EnableInlineShortcodes, qt.IsTrue)
+ c.Assert(pc.Exec.Allow.Accept("a"), qt.IsTrue)
+ c.Assert(pc.Exec.Allow.Accept("d"), qt.IsFalse)
+ c.Assert(pc.Exec.OsEnv.Accept("a"), qt.IsTrue)
+ c.Assert(pc.Exec.OsEnv.Accept("e"), qt.IsFalse)
+ c.Assert(pc.Funcs.Getenv.Accept("a"), qt.IsTrue)
+ c.Assert(pc.Funcs.Getenv.Accept("c"), qt.IsFalse)
+
+ })
+
+ c.Run("String whitelist", func(c *qt.C) {
+ c.Parallel()
+ tomlConfig := `
+
+
+someOtherValue = "bar"
+
+[security]
+[security.exec]
+allow="a"
+osEnv="b"
+
+`
+
+ cfg, err := config.FromConfigString(tomlConfig, "toml")
+ c.Assert(err, qt.IsNil)
+
+ pc, err := DecodeConfig(cfg)
+ c.Assert(err, qt.IsNil)
+ c.Assert(pc, qt.Not(qt.IsNil))
+ c.Assert(pc.Exec.Allow.Accept("a"), qt.IsTrue)
+ c.Assert(pc.Exec.Allow.Accept("d"), qt.IsFalse)
+ c.Assert(pc.Exec.OsEnv.Accept("b"), qt.IsTrue)
+ c.Assert(pc.Exec.OsEnv.Accept("e"), qt.IsFalse)
+
+ })
+
+ c.Run("Default exec.osEnv", func(c *qt.C) {
+ c.Parallel()
+ tomlConfig := `
+
+
+someOtherValue = "bar"
+
+[security]
+[security.exec]
+allow="a"
+
+`
+
+ cfg, err := config.FromConfigString(tomlConfig, "toml")
+ c.Assert(err, qt.IsNil)
+
+ pc, err := DecodeConfig(cfg)
+ c.Assert(err, qt.IsNil)
+ c.Assert(pc, qt.Not(qt.IsNil))
+ c.Assert(pc.Exec.Allow.Accept("a"), qt.IsTrue)
+ c.Assert(pc.Exec.OsEnv.Accept("PATH"), qt.IsTrue)
+ c.Assert(pc.Exec.OsEnv.Accept("e"), qt.IsFalse)
+
+ })
+
+ c.Run("Enable inline shortcodes, legacy", func(c *qt.C) {
+ c.Parallel()
+ tomlConfig := `
+
+
+someOtherValue = "bar"
+enableInlineShortcodes=true
+
+[security]
+[security.exec]
+allow="a"
+osEnv="b"
+
+`
+
+ cfg, err := config.FromConfigString(tomlConfig, "toml")
+ c.Assert(err, qt.IsNil)
+
+ pc, err := DecodeConfig(cfg)
+ c.Assert(err, qt.IsNil)
+ c.Assert(pc.EnableInlineShortcodes, qt.IsTrue)
+
+ })
+
+}
+
+func TestToTOML(t *testing.T) {
+ c := qt.New(t)
+
+ got := DefaultConfig.ToTOML()
+
+ c.Assert(got, qt.Equals,
+ "[security]\n enableInlineShortcodes = false\n\n [security.exec]\n allow = ['^dart-sass-embedded$', '^go$', '^npx$', '^postcss$']\n osEnv = ['(?i)^((HTTPS?|NO)_PROXY|PATH(EXT)?|APPDATA|TE?MP|TERM)$']\n\n [security.funcs]\n getenv = ['^HUGO_']\n\n [security.http]\n methods = ['(?i)GET|POST']\n urls = ['.*']",
+ )
+}
+
+func TestDecodeConfigDefault(t *testing.T) {
+ t.Parallel()
+ c := qt.New(t)
+
+ pc, err := DecodeConfig(config.New())
+ c.Assert(err, qt.IsNil)
+ c.Assert(pc, qt.Not(qt.IsNil))
+ c.Assert(pc.Exec.Allow.Accept("a"), qt.IsFalse)
+ c.Assert(pc.Exec.Allow.Accept("npx"), qt.IsTrue)
+ c.Assert(pc.Exec.Allow.Accept("Npx"), qt.IsFalse)
+ c.Assert(pc.Exec.OsEnv.Accept("a"), qt.IsFalse)
+ c.Assert(pc.Exec.OsEnv.Accept("PATH"), qt.IsTrue)
+ c.Assert(pc.Exec.OsEnv.Accept("e"), qt.IsFalse)
+
+ c.Assert(pc.HTTP.URLs.Accept("https://example.org"), qt.IsTrue)
+ c.Assert(pc.HTTP.Methods.Accept("POST"), qt.IsTrue)
+ c.Assert(pc.HTTP.Methods.Accept("GET"), qt.IsTrue)
+ c.Assert(pc.HTTP.Methods.Accept("get"), qt.IsTrue)
+ c.Assert(pc.HTTP.Methods.Accept("DELETE"), qt.IsFalse)
+}
